Social Phobias Anxiety Medications Make A Difference
from:People who live with social anxiety disorders very often find themselves not living at all. Fears of scrutiny, rejection, ridicule and even failure can plague those with this condition. In many cases, they shun social situations all together and avoid living life to its fullest. When overcoming the symptoms and getting on with life matters, doctors often prescribe patients social phobias anxiety medications. Several classes of medication can make a very big impact on keeping the symptoms of this condition in check so people can get on with their lives.
In many cases, social phobias anxiety medications are also the same prescriptions used to treat depression. Two major classes of anti-depressants are used to treat social phobias - Selective Serotonin Reuptake Inhibitors and Monoamine Oxidase Inhibitor antidepressants.
Understanding SSRIs
Social phobias anxiety medications in the SSRI class work by preventing the neurotransmitter serotonin from reabsorbing into certain cells in the brain. This leaves more serotonin in the brain. Issues with this particular neurotransmitter have been connected with anxiety disorders and depression both.
SSRIs are commonly marketed under several brand names. Social phobias anxiety medications such as Prozac and Zoloft are SSRIs.
Understanding MAOIs
Like SSRIs, MAOIs work by inhibiting chemical activity in the brain. In this case, MAOI social phobias anxiety medications stop the breakdown of monoamine, leaving more of it in the brain. This particular class of social phobias anxiety medications is useful for treating depression, social phobia disorders and a number of other mental health concerns.
MAOIs include several different names of drugs. They include Aurorix, Nardil and Marplan.
Why Medications Are Important
Social phobias anxiety medications are generally only one prong of an overall treatment plan for this type of condition. Since social phobias tend to get worse if they are untreated, but can often be overcome if they are, medication and therapy are both seen as crucial.
Therapy is generally used to help give people suffering from social phobias the tools they need to cope and overcome. Medications are used to help people cope with symptoms in the short-term, so they are more free to undergo needed therapy.
During therapy, patients quite often also undergo some type of self-esteem building exercises. This can be an important aspect of dealing with social phobias.
Social phobias anxiety medications are considered valuable tools in the treatment of this type of condition. When constant fears of rejection, failure, scrutiny and more plague a person and make that person avoid interaction, quality of life diminishes. With the right treatments, people with social phobias can regain control and learn to enjoy life once more.
